Der AMD Ryzen 7 4800H ist ein Mobilprozessor für große Notebooks (z.B. Gaming-Laptops) basierend auf die Renoir Generation. Der SoC beinhaltet acht Zen 2 Kerne (Octa-Core CPU) welche mit bis zu 4,2 GHz getaktet werden (Turbo) und SMT / Hyperthreading (16 Threads) unterstützen. Der Chip wird im modernen 7nm Prozess bei TSMC gefertigt und soll laut AMD eine 2x verbesserte Performance pro Watt bieten als die Ryzen 3000 APUs (z.B. den Ryzen 7 3750H Vorgänger).
Laut AMD ist der Ryzen 7 4800H um 5% schneller als ein 9750H im Einzelkernbenchmark des Cinebench R20 und 46% schneller im Multikernbenchmark. Damit würde sich die CPU zwischen dem Intel Core i9-9880H und 9980HK an der Spitze von mobilen Prozessoren einordnen. Damit eignet sie sich auch für anspruchsvolle Anforderungen sehr gut.
Der SoC integriert neben den acht Prozessorkernen noch eine Radeon RX Vega 7 Grafikkarte mit 7 CUs und bis zu 1600 MHz Takt, einen Dual-Channel DDR4-3200 / LPDDR4-4266 Speicherkontroller und 8 MB Level 3 Cache. Der TDP ist laut AMD von 35 - 54 Watt konfigurierbar (45 Watt Default). Daher ist der Chip für große und schwere Notebooks vorgesehen und benötigt, trotz des effizienten 7nm Herstellungsprozesses, eine gute Kühlung um die Leistung auch dauerhaft zu erbringen.

Der AMD Ryzen 5 4500U ist ein Mobilprozessor für kleine und leichte Notebooks basierend auf die Renoir Generation. Der SoC beinhaltet sechs Zen 2 Kerne (Octa-Core CPU) (ohne SMT/Hyperthreading = 6 Threads) welche mit bis zu 4 GHz getaktet werden (Turbo). Der Chip wird im modernen 7nm Prozess bei TSMC gefertigt und soll laut AMD eine 2x verbesserte Performance pro Watt bieten als die Ryzen 3000 APUs (z.B. den Ryzen 5 3500U Vorgänger).
Im Vergleich zum minimal schnelleren Ryzen 5 4600U, bietet der 4500U kein SMT / Hyperthreading aber einen höheren Basistakt. Dadurch sollte die Prozessor-Performance sehr ähnlich ausfallen.
Der SoC integriert neben den sechs Prozessorkernen noch eine Radeon RX Vega 6 Grafikkarte mit 6 CUs und bis zu 1500 MHz Takt, einen Dual-Channel DDR4-3200 / LPDDR4-4266 Speicherkontroller und 8 MB Level 3 Cache. Der TDP ist laut AMD von 10 - 25 Watt konfigurierbar (15 Watt Default). Daher ist der Chip auch für kleine und leichte Notebooks geeignet.

Der AMD Ryzen 3 4300U ist ein Mobilprozessor für kleine und leichte Notebooks basierend auf die Renoir Generation. Der SoC beinhaltet vier Zen 2 Kerne (Quad-Core CPU) (ohne SMT/Hyperthreading = 4 Threads) welche mit bis zu 3,7 GHz getaktet werden (Turbo). Der Chip wird im modernen 7nm Prozess bei TSMC gefertigt und soll laut AMD eine 2x verbesserte Performance pro Watt bieten als die Ryzen 3000 APUs (z.B. den Ryzen 3 3300U Vorgänger).
Durch die neuen Zen 2 Kerne und die hohe Taktfrequenz, sollte der Ryzen 3 4300U sich auf dem Niveau des alten Ryzen 5 3500U einreihen. Die schnelleren Ryzen 5 4000er und Ryzen 7 4000er Modelle bieten mehr Kerne und damit auch eine deutlich höhere Multithread-Leistung.
Der SoC integriert neben den sechs Prozessorkernen noch eine Radeon RX Vega 5 Grafikkarte mit 5 CUs und bis zu 1400 MHz Takt, einen Dual-Channel DDR4-3200 / LPDDR4-4266 Speicherkontroller und 4 MB Level 3 Cache. Der TDP ist laut AMD von 10 - 25 Watt konfigurierbar (15 Watt Default). Daher ist der Chip auch für kleine und leichte Notebooks geeignet.
